What does a Wheel Stopper do?
A wheel stopper also known as a wheel block, car stopper, parking curb, or parking block is a long lasting low profile barrier which we put at the end of a parking space to avoid vehicles from moving too far forward or back. They are usually installed in parking lots, garages and driveways and serve as a physical boundary which in turn guarantees proper and even parking alignment.
They help:
- Prevent over-parking
- Protect walls and sidewalks
- Avoid accidental collisions
- Guide with turn by turn directions for reversing or parking in.
- Maintain organized parking layouts
In areas of limited space which also play host to a variety of vehicle sizes and in which safety is a top priority, wheel stopper systems are a requirement.

Wheel Stop Size and Dimension Specifications
Different regions and which industries put forth their own standards. For example:.
- Length: 90cm, 1m, 1.2m, 1.8m.
- Height: From 100mm to 150mm.
- Width: From 150mm to 200mm.
Rubber wheel stopper options are usually lighter and the concrete ones range from 25 to 60 kg per piece.

Wheel Stopper Care and Wear Resistance.
- Wheel stops need little maintenance. Also to get the best out of them:.
- Inspect bolts every 6–12 months
- Replace reflective tape if it fades
- Check alignment after heavy impact
- Keep surrounding areas clean
Rubber wheel stoppers which may last up to 10 years in some cases but as little as 5 in others.
